    Duomo Museum and Santa Reparata

    June 11, 2022 in Italy ⋅ ☀️ 28 °C

    The museum had artifacts from the Cathedral of Florence. These were moved for display and better preservation. It contains items from both the Cathedral and the Baptistry.

    Santa Reparata is the former cathedral of Florence. It currently lies UNDER the Cathedral of Florence as Santa Reparata was demolished during the current Cathedral's construction. It was amazing the excavations had uncovered and restored. Full mosaic floors and tombs of Cardinals were on displays in this basement.Read more
